Two more mods went on today.
First, I got the car tinted. After I read Dues' horror story, I wanted to play it safe. I got an HP32 tint (not sure what that means) all the way around. Its dark, but not dark enough to draw too much attention to it.
What do you guys think?
Then I installed the fogs. On my original MAX I bought those ~$50 PIAA GT-X super plasmas and like most others, had one burn out on me.
So now, I installed these $5 dollar blue H3's off ebay. They are listed to be 100W and guess what.....they look EXACTLY the same as the PIAA's before they burned out!! See for yourself from the pics. These do not exactly match the HID's, but I honestly dont think there is a way to match them with just switching out the bulbs. But for 5 dollars, they're good enough for me.

The only "32" that Solarguard makes is the HP Charcoal 32, which is basically 32% tint with 15% reflectivity and a bunch of other stats that only they list on their film...
Looks darker though, but I guess it depends on whether or not you did the windshield and if your interior is dark (which I think is the case for both).

Yea, the pic is with the new ebay bulb.
Replacing the fogs is easy. If you have an aftermarket intake then you should be able to just reach in there. On the passenger side, remove that top cover with the plastic pushpins and remove the windsheild wiper fluid tube by turning and pulling. Once you have those off you should be able to reach in easily.
The whole thing took me 10min. ITS ALL ABOUT THE STICKIES!!!!
